About The Position

We are looking for a Lighting Technician to bring support to our Lighting team. In this position, you will be responsible for the safe setup, use and maintenance required for show readiness of Lighting systems and equipment. The Lighting Technician’s tasks include but are not limited to: running follow spot/deck cue tracks, maintaining cue track documentation, inspecting and maintaining Lighting equipment, as well as support the show needs during rehearsals and performances. The ideal candidate will have a team player mindset The Lighting Technician will have the opportunity to: - Learn and run follow spot/deck cue tracks, as directed by leadership, for performances, artist training, maintenance and special events; - Ensure the safe setup, use and maintenance of Lighting systems and equipment used during performances, rehearsals and training periods by completing inspections in a timely manner; - Use safe wiring practices and maintain equipment, in accordance with industry standards for safe operations; - Assist with inventory, ensuring equipment and supplies are stocked in sufficient quantity to ensure the on-going needs of the production; - Update all necessary maintenance and inspection records/documentation to ensure lighting systems and equipment are in compliance with Cirque du Soleil Entertainment Group established policies and standards; - Maintain cue track documentation and participate in cue track rotation, as directed; - Participate in special projects, including the construction and installation of new show elements, and other projects that include Lighting elements or other needs that may fall within the department’s specialty, as directed; Maintain flexible schedule for such projects; - Develop a thorough knowledge of Lighting department equipment specific to the production, in order to operate it safely; - Assist with the cross-training program to backup console operators and moving light repair Technicians; - Adhere to and promote all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) regulations as they pertain to the safe operation of all elements related to the show; participate in all required health and safety classes and emergency rescue procedure training; - Contribute to a safe and positive working environment at all times by adhering to and following all Cirque du Soleil Entertainment Group standards, values, policies and regulations pertaining to safety using equipment and established working methods; - Assist other departments when necessary for cross-departmental support; - Complete other job-related duties as assigned.

Requirements

  • At least two years of previous experience as a professional Lighting Technician or equivalent training in a similar environment
  • Basic knowledge of digital test equipment for troubleshooting and repairs
  • Comprehension of basic principles of: o AC/DC electricity; o Basic electronics; o Computer operations, as it pertains to lighting systems.
  • Working knowledge of Microsoft Office; knowledge of AutoCAD is an asset
  • Ability to obtain OSHA 10 course completion card
  • Ability to perform the essential functions of the job including, but not limited to: crouching, kneeling, standing, lifting, sometimes for extended amounts of time; lifting at least 50lbs unassisted, etc.; Full list of essential functions will be sent in the offer.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ions
  • Fluent in English, both written and spoken
  • Verification of the right to work in the United States for Cirque du Soleil Entertainment Group, as demonstrated by completion of the Form I-9 upon hire and the submission of acceptable documentation (as noted on the Form I-9) verifying one’s identity and work authorization
  • Although not a pre-employment condition, this position requires you to be fully vaccinated. If requested, reasonable accommodations will be considered.
